Illegal use of troops: US court slams Trump, judge rules Guard deployment in California broke law; LA immigration protests at center of clash

A federal judge has ruled that US President Donald Trump’s use of National Guard troops during immigration enforcement protests in Southern California violated federal law. US District Judge Charles Breyer, sitting in San Francisco, issued the ruling, finding that the administration overstepped legal boundaries by deploying troops to the Los Angeles area over the summer….

Free speech clash: Supreme Court allows Mississippi’s law requiring age verification for minors; tech giants oppose mandate

US Supreme Court (AP image) The US Supreme Court on Thursday declined to temporarily block a Mississippi law that requires age verification and parental consent for minors to use social media platforms.The law, aimed at protecting young people from potential online harm, will remain in effect while legal challenges continue.
